Users who work with AI regularly can save language, format, or style preferences to avoid repeating them. This helps keep responses consistent across different MCP clients.
When work is spread across multiple sessions or clients, saved memories can carry context forward. This is useful for project background, to-do items, or personal work habits.
Users can store important information in personal memory and search it when needed. This makes it faster to recover past notes without manually digging through old chats.
It is an MCP tool that gives AI assistants persistent personal memory. Based on the description, it supports saving, searching, and recalling memories across MCP clients.
The provided information clearly mentions three capabilities: save memories, search memories, and recall memories. For any advanced features beyond that, see the source repository.
